
2. Omega 6 Oils
If you are using vegetable oil to cook in or any type of oil really, if it contains too much omega six it may be the cause of any inflammation symptoms that you are experiencing. While omega 3 fatty acids are very good for you and even recommended to be added to a regular healthy diet, omega 6 fatty acids are not as good for you and they are a contributor to inflammation.
The way that omega 6 fatty acids are the way they are converted into prostaglandins. Additionally, these fatty acids also create proteins that promote inflammation within the body. Avoiding foods that contain high amounts of omega-six fatty acids is important to reduce inflammation in the body through your diet. Simply changing to using oils that do not contain omega-six fatty acids is a simple way to reduce inflammation that may be occurring within the body.
